2 Pieces of Red Mark Pu-er Tea Cakes, Circa 1950s
ESTIMATE:HK$ 1,000,000 - 1,800,000
年份:約1950年代
工序:生茶
茶廠:勐海茶廠
倉儲:偏乾倉/自然倉
數量:兩片
總重量:約317g, 322g連包裝

One of the pieces is an early Red Mark with a wrapper printed in bold characters. Both cakes are in excellent condition with well-preserved wrappers, stored under natural to mild dry storage. The cakes display a dark, glossy surface, tightly compressed with wild Menghai leaves of thick, sturdy strips, exuding a deep camphor fragrance. When infused, the liquor shows a bright, clear chestnut-red hue. The flavour is rich and layered, with refined sweetness and a lingering, elegant finish.
